- Select File > Info.
- Click on Protect Workbook and choose Encrypt with Password.
- Enter a password and confirm it.
- Protect your form and reopen it.
- Fill it out as a regular user would and save a copy to test its functionality.
Method 2: Using UserForms with VBA
Step-by-Step Guide
- Enable Developer Tools:
- Go to File > Options.
- Select Customize Ribbon.
- In the left dropdown menu, select All Tabs.
- Check the box next to Developer and click Add.
- Create a UserForm:
- Click on the Developer tab.
- Select Visual Basic to open the Visual Basic for Applications (VBA) editor.
- Insert a new user form by clicking on Insert > User Form.
- Design the UserForm:
- Add labels and text boxes for data entry.
- Add command buttons for operations like inserting entries or refreshing the form.
- Create a Macro:
- In the VBA editor, insert a new module.
- Write a macro to show the user form when a button is clicked (e.g.,
Sub Enter_Employee_Details() Employee_Form.Show End Sub
).
- Assign the Macro:
- Go back to your Excel sheet and insert a button.
- Assign the macro to the button by selecting it and clicking Assign Macro.
Method 3: Using Built-in Data Entry Form
Step-by-Step Guide
- Convert Data to Table:
- Select any cell in your dataset and press
Ctrl + T
to convert it to a table.
- Select any cell in your dataset and press
- Add Data Entry Form:
- Place the cursor anywhere within the table and click the Form button.
- This will automatically create a data entry form with fields corresponding to the column headings.
- Enter Form Data:
- Click on any cell within your table and select the Form icon to add new data.
- Input the information about the new record in the appropriate fields and hit the New button to see it show up in the table.
Best Practices for Creating Forms in Excel
- Organize Information Flow: Arrange worksheets so that information flows from top left to bottom right to improve user understanding.
- Label Columns and Rows: Use simple, consistent naming conventions for clarity.
- Keep Formulas Readable: Break long formulas down into smaller parts for better readability.
- Avoid Repetitive Formulas: Minimize the risk of errors by calculating formulas only once.
- Avoid Hard-Coded Numbers: Use input cells for fixed values in formulas for easier updates.
- Do Not Merge Cells: Merged cells can create issues with calculations; use formatting instead.
- Keep Conditional Formatting Simple: Use straightforward rules to enhance, not obscure, user understanding.
- Use Positive Numbers: Encourage input of positive values to reduce errors.
- Be Clear About Units and Number Formats: Always label units and formats in spreadsheets.
- Use Simple Ranges: Add empty rows or columns to reduce formula errors from future edits.
Conclusion
By following these methods and best practices, you can create professional-looking forms in Excel that are both functional and user-friendly. Whether you’re using form controls, UserForms with VBA, or the built-in data entry form, these steps will help you streamline your data collection and organization processes.
Learn More and Enhance Your Skills
If you’re interested in advancing your Excel skills further, consider checking out our other resources:
- Learn Excel Quickly: Top Tips and Resources for Fast Mastery
- How to Learn Excel Fast for Free: A Complete Guide
Support Us
Your support helps us continue providing quality content. Consider donating or purchasing our ebook to enhance your Excel knowledge and skills today!